Añadir al carritoMontanus' edition of a renowned famous Latin schoolbook written by Erasmus, one of the most used Latin schoolbooks for centuries, as it discusses all basic scholarly and moral issues. With Erasmus' preface-letter to Froben at Basel, dated 1524, and the Vita Erasmi preceding the Colloquia, as well as two indices of authors and di…alogues. Included at the end is a short essay explaining the usefulness of the book.With a few 17th-century annotations on the engraved and letterpress title pages (resp. "1662" and "Besnier"). The engraved title page is cut slightly short (not affecting the engraving). Otherwise in very good condition.l Bibl. Belg. II, E 572; Erasmus Coll. City Library Rotterdam p. 50; STCN 850071909 (9 copies); Vander Haeghen, p. 40. 18th-century richly gold-tooled red morocco, both boards show a triple fillet frame with small cornerpieces in the inside corners and an oval armorial centrepiece (crowned fleur-de-lis flanked by two knights), gold-tooled spine with "Erasmus" lettered in gold, gold-tooled board edges and turn ins, gilt edges, marbled endpapers. With an engraved title page, a full-page engraving showing Erasmus, woodcut decorated initials, and several woodcut head- and tailpieces. Pages: [1], [1 blank], [1], [1 blank], [20], 820, 44 pp. Including: Coronis apologetica pro colloquiis Erasmi, ex ipsius scriptis, quantum per otium licuit, fideliter collecta à P.S. accedit ejusdem De Collequiorum utilitate dissertatio.

Later Leipzig edition, revised by Arnoldus Montanus. Latin edition. With engraved frontispiece, engraved allegorical title page, and several woodcut vignettes and initials. Vellum slightly soiled, with a tiny loss to the upper cover and a small tear (approx. 2 cm) to the spine. Front endpaper with a small loss, manuscript annotations in an early hand on the front free endpaper, and several contemporary ink annotations in the text. As usual, the catchword on fol. 12 verso does not correspond to the beginning of the text on p. 1. A good to very good copy.
